Construction of Keureuto Dam, Aceh reaches 68%

21 February 2020 17:48

JAKARTA - The Ministry of Public Works and Public Housing (PUPR) is completing the construction of Keureuto Dam to reduce the risk of flooding in the North Aceh District, Aceh Province. Dam construction is part of a master plan for flood control in North Aceh Regency.

The Keureuto Dam dams the Krueng Keureuto River which has 6 tributaries as the main cause of flooding in the downstream areas. With a capacity of 215 million / m3, it has the main benefit of reducing floods that often inundate areas in Lhoksukon as the capital of North Aceh Regency.

This dam has been built since 2015 with an APBN budget of Rp 1.7 trillion. The construction is carried out in stages through three packages with each contractor, PT. Brantas Abipraya (Persero), PT. Pelita Nusa Perkasa (KSO) for package 1, PT. Wijaya Karya (Persero) Tbk for package 2, PT. Hutama Karya-Perapen for package 3. At present, the dam construction progress has reached 68% and is targeted to be completed by the end of 2020.

The Keureuto Dam is one of 49 new dams built by the Ministry of PUPR through the Sumatra River Basin 1 Directorate General of Water Resources in the 2015-2019 period as an effort to realize water security and food sovereignty in Aceh Province. (LM)
